Transaction ad0b32ff62f4cd722e0d873c466c1aedaaa609474efd8144e3aa4107fe3e0500
1 Input
1 Outputs
- ad0b32ff62f4cd722e0d873c466c1aedaaa609474efd8144e3aa4107fe3e0500:0
value 5164140
address 3BMEXA4eugmSyWi5q8h5CwyTndroCWJZYv